You are looking at computer game Celtic Kings: The Punic Wars 'Haemimont Games has done an admirable job of bringing together two different types of games. 8.4/10' - Gamespot Inspired by the history of The Punic Wars, this real-time strategy game invites players to experience the brutal warfare between the Romans and Gauls. The two new nations in this next installment in the Celtic Kings series are accompanied with their own units and historical buildings. The game also contains two unique single-player campaigns, new terrain types, custom maps and special enhancements to the Celtic Kings engine. While remaining true to the game's original concept, Celtic Kings incorporates real-time strategy and role-playing elements, offering players a distinctive experience in discovering a conflict that occurred over 2000 years ago. Features: * Large maps complete with neutral settlements and camps that present a threat to all players. * Player control heroes that command armies of up to 50 units on their own, providing them with an additional bonus in battle. * Settlements have their own resources they can spend locally or transport elsewhere. * Rituals performed in places of ancient worship that effect the entire world. * Military units have the ability to capture resource caravans, outposts and even entire cities and settlements. * Ships and shipyards providing for sea battles or transport of armies and resources from one shore to another. * Upgrades that increase the might of your armies and the power of your settlements. * A vast array of items that bring specific bonuses to the unit carrying them. * For 1 to 8 players over LAN or Internet.
